Standard Chartered Bank — Manhattan CC ending 4777- Crad closed 10 years ago shows an overdue of Rs. 1,21,141/- | |||
Recently I got to know from my CIBIL report, a SCB credit card account number ([protected]) is shown as written off with outstanding Rs. 1, 21, 141/-. On inquiry with Standard chartered bank, I got to know that the due is for a Manhattan credit card- [protected], Which was closed in April, 2006. Jan, 2006 - Due was around Rs. 40K Feb, 2006 - Paid Rs. 41000/- on 03-Feb, 06. However bill due shown was 43K Apr, 2006 - Wrong late fees and interest were charged and again bill due shown was Rs. 4010/- On customer care complaint about unnecessary late fees with a lady officer, (don’t remember her name), she agreed to revert the late fees and interest charges of Rs. 2010/-. I paid the rest of amount Rs. 2000/- and card was closed in Apr, 06. No more bill received after Apr, 2006 since the credit card was closed. No further mail received for any dues or any statements. The amount Rs 2010/- which was supposed to be reverted was not reverted. I am informed by customer care that Rs. 2010/- due has become 1.2+ Lacs now. Since it is 10 year old card for which I don't have any old statements and closure letters. I would request SCB officer to revert these penalties and clear my CIBIL records ASAP.
